Missing emails
I have stopped receiving any emails through Sky Yahoo since Friday, 29th May 2025. Sky virtual assistant was no help at all. Has anybody else had thisproblem andif so how did you solve it?

Re: Missing emails
Login to your online account:
https://skyid.sky.com/signin/email/
Go to Settings (the screw icon on the right hand side) > More Settings > Filters and remove anything that you did not setup.
Then go to Settings > More Settings > Mailboxes > Your email address > Reply-to address
And again remove anything here that you did not setup.
If you have had to make a change then logout and change your password:
https://skyid.sky.com/resetpassword/
You might want to give some thought to setting up two step verification as per this:
https://www.sky.com/help/home/sky-yahoo-mail/two-step-verif/articles/two-step-verification
If you do set this up it in important that you make a note of and keep safe the recovery code.

Re: Missing emails
Thank you for the help. I finally found that the emails had been sent to Archive. I have now recovered them and removed the settings as you suggested. Re: Missing emails
Hi Crumblypam - I had a very similar problem recently, all my draft emails kept being saved to my Inbox, not to my Drafts folder. Someone else on the forum very helpfully suggested I look at the filters and despite never having set up a filter, there was one there diverting all my drafts. So I deleted the filter, and changed my Sky Yahoo mail password for good measure. So far all is fine. Other than my husband has now discovered he has a similar problem today . . . all very odd!
